%description
|
|
Connect Perl with AI using the Model Context Protocol (MCP). Currently this
|
|
module is focused on tool calling, but it will be extended to support other
|
|
MCP features in the future. At its core, MCP is all about text processing,
|
|
making it a great fit for Perl.
|
|
|
|
Streamable HTTP Transport
|
|
Use the MCP::Server/"to_action" method to add an MCP endpoint to any
|
|
Mojolicious application. The tool name and description are used for
|
|
discovery, and the at https://json-schema.org is used to validate the
|
|
input.
|
|
|
|
use Mojolicious::Lite -signatures;
|
|
|
|
use MCP::Server;
|
|
|
|
my $server = MCP::Server->new;
|
|
$server->tool(
|
|
name => 'echo',
|
|
description => 'Echo the input text',
|
|
input_schema => {type => 'object', properties => {msg => {type => 'string'}}, required => ['msg']},
|
|
code => sub ($tool, $args) {
|
|
return "Echo: $args->{msg}";
|
|
}
|
|
);
|
|
|
|
any '/mcp' => $server->to_action;
|
|
|
|
app->start;
|
|
|
|
Authentication can be added by the web application, just like for any
|
|
other route. To allow for MCP applications to scale with prefork web
|
|
servers, server to client streaming is currentlly avoided when
|
|
possible.
|
|
|
|
Stdio Transport
|
|
Build local command line applications and use the stdio transport for
|
|
testing with the MCP::Server/"to_stdio" method.
|
|
|
|
use Mojo::Base -strict, -signatures;
|
|
|
|
use MCP::Server;
|
|
|
|
my $server = MCP::Server->new;
|
|
$server->tool(
|
|
name => 'echo',
|
|
description => 'Echo the input text',
|
|
input_schema => {type => 'object', properties => {msg => {type => 'string'}}, required => ['msg']},
|
|
code => sub ($tool, $args) {
|
|
return "Echo: $args->{msg}";
|
|
}
|
|
);
|
|
|
|
$server->to_stdio;
|
|
|
|
Just run the script and type requests on the command line.
|
|
|
|
$ perl examples/echo_stdio.pl
|
|
{"jsonrpc":"2.0","id":"1","method":"tools/list"}
|
|
{"jsonrpc":"2.0","id":"2","method":"tools/call","params":{"name":"echo","arguments":{"msg":"hello perl"}}}
